### The Step-by-Step Process of Tooth Extraction

The process in Thailand is very systematic, and dental teams take time to guide patients before and after the procedure. Here’s how it typically goes:

**1. Consultation and Diagnosis:**

Everything begins with a dental consultation, which may include an X-ray or digital scan. The dentist will evaluate whether the tooth really needs to be removed or if there’s an alternative treatment. Patients receive a clear explanation of the procedure, cost, and expected recovery period before making any decisions.

**2. Preparation and Anesthesia:**

On the day of the extraction, the dentist cleans the area and administers a local anesthetic. Most Thai dentists are gentle and take extra care to ensure the patient is fully comfortable before proceeding. In some cases, especially for impacted wisdom teeth, mild sedation may be used to help patients relax.

**3. Tooth Removal:**

Once the area is numb, the dentist carefully loosens and removes the tooth using specialized instruments. Thanks to modern techniques and equipment, the procedure is generally quick and smooth. Many patients are surprised at how little pain they actually feel.

**4. Post-Extraction Care:**

After the tooth is removed, the dentist provides clear instructions for aftercare. These include how to manage any mild swelling, when to take prescribed medications, and what foods to avoid for the next few days. ### Patient Guidance and Recovery Tips

After your extraction, following the dentist’s post-care instructions is very important. Here are some commonly recommended guidelines you might hear in Thailand:

- Avoid rinsing your mouth too aggressively for the first 24 hours.

- Stick to soft foods like soup, congee, or yogurt.

- Refrain from smoking or drinking alcohol during the healing period.

- Apply a cold compress outside your cheek if there’s swelling.

- Keep up with gentle brushing but avoid the extraction site.

Dentists often remind patients that discomfort for the first day or two is normal. However, if there’s persistent bleeding or pain, you should return to the clinic for a quick check-up. Thai dental staff are approachable, so you’ll always feel supported.
